Sayyiduna Abu Hurairah (may Allah be pleased with him) narrated from the Messenger of Allah (peace and blessings be upon him), he (peace be upon him) said: "One prayer in this mosque of mine is better than a thousand prayers in other mosques, except for Al-Masjid Al-Haram."

Benefits: Performing prayer in Masjid al-Haram (the Sacred Mosque at the Ka'bah) earns the reward of one hundred thousand prayers; in the Prophet’s Mosque (Masjid an-Nabawi), one prayer earns the reward of one thousand prayers; and in al-Aqsa Mosque (Bayt al-Maqdis), one prayer earns the reward of five hundred prayers.
